Ellyn Angelotti Kamke

Associate General Counsel, Corporate Transactions and Privacy, Raymond James Financial

Ellyn Kamke is an Associate General Counsel for Raymond James Financial, leading a team that supports privacy, information security, intellectual property and corporate transactions matters for the firm.

She has experience in providing legal advice and guidance for procurement, intellectual property, information technology and real estate agreements. Ellyn has previously led legal teams in the SaaS industry and was a General Counsel for a business intelligence company.

Ellyn supports inclusion initiatives at Raymond James, as the chair of the Legal Associate Experience Committee, and in the legal industry, through the Leadership Council on Legal Diversity (LCLD) Alumni Executive Council, where she serves as co-chair of its Alumni Symposium initiative. She is a 2022 LCLD Fellow and was a 2017 LCLD Pathfinder. She was previously Chair of the Board of Trustees for American Stage Theater.

After a decade-long career in the journalism industry, she earned her Juris Doctorate from Stetson University College of Law where she was also awarded the Judge Raphael Steinhardt award for character and leadership.
